Output e52bf2c860223a84e3ab6e43c0e3ca7c9db03ac1cd3a47a911a09a62c4f200b3:0

value
137049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aabcc5bff821959b41ecbd9a6b4ad3420b6724fc OP_EQUAL
address
3HFnwJ63d4KwEnxH5RnGfv4QNyRfC3exU7
transaction
e52bf2c860223a84e3ab6e43c0e3ca7c9db03ac1cd3a47a911a09a62c4f200b3
spent
true